Africa: Tourism Ethiopia honours hospitality expert Kumneger Teketel for 6 years of MICE initiative

Leading Ethiopian tourism expert and CEO of OZZIE Business and Hospitality Consultancy, Kumneger Teketel W/Gebriel has been honoured by Tourism Ethiopia for his efforts and initiative in the past six years toward the growth of MICE tourism in the country.

Kumneger Teketel is one of Africa’s leading tourism experts, especially in the field of hospitality.

In October 2013, he debuted the Hotel Show Africa in Addis Ababa. The Hotel Show Africa:Hospitality and Tourism Trade Show is the first and the largest hospitality and tourism event in Ethiopia and one of the biggest in Africa.

In 2019, Addis Ababa City Administration Cabinet led by its Mayor, His Excellency Eng. Takele Uma appointed Teketel as Director of Addis Ababa Convention Bureau to reposition the city and country’s MICE industry.

In 2018, Kumneger Teketel bagged the Africa Legend of Travel Award, the highest honours given at the annual Akwaaba African Travel Market, the leading Pan-African Tourism Expo.

The following year, he was a recipient of the African Top 100 Global Tourism Personalities Award which he recieved at the 15th Akwaaba African Travel Market held in Lagos, Nigeria.
